Hi there,

 

I'm new to Emby. Just installed it on my Synology 218+ by adding the repo to the package center. I suppose it's the latest available.

 

I have a .pfx certificate generated from the let's encrypt one that I use for the nas. Password protected.

 

Now without any other modifications I go to the remote connection settings, I enable, I link the certificate path, put the certificate password, make the server accept or require secure connections, save and restart the server, both from the UI, and the package center.

 

I have both ports forwarded from the router 8096, 8920 to my nas.

 

Now when I access the server again, it does not work on port 8920. The dashboard only shows HTTP listeners for local and remote (that work), nothing about HTTPS, not for local, not for remote.

 

Does this even work ?

 

Thank you for your time.

 

PS: I installed and reinstalled a few times already, to the same result.

Hey Luke, I know what the problem was. I have an external SSD attached via eSATA to my NAS (satashare). If I put the certificate there, even if I give permissions It does not work. It has to be on the same drive as Emby (volume1). Maybe this is to be expected or something you might want to consider.
